Beta carotene is provitamin essential role for vitamin A formation. Most of vitamin A sources are ?-carotene. In the body, ?-carotene will be converted into vitamin A. Chilies are considered as one of the essential food. Chillies are known as very good sources of ?-carotene. Therefore, it is important to conduct a research in order to observe the content of ?-carotene in the chillies using visible spectrophotometry. Fresh chillies were extracted with a mixture of hexane:acetone:ethanol (2:1:1) v/v using a maceration method. After the extraction process was complete, aquabidest was added. The extraction result was non-polar phase. It was separated and evaporated. The residue was further subjected to qualitative and quantitative analysis 102 Pharma?iana, Vol. 4, No. 2, 2014: 101-109 obtained. Qualitative analysis by using Carr-Price method. Determination of ?-carotene was conducted using visible spectrophotometry method at 452,4 nm. The qualitative test results showed that the Capsicum annuum L. Var. abreviatum Fingerhuth, Capsicum annuum L. Var. Longum sendt) and Capsicum frutescens L. contain ?-carotene. From the research, it was obtained that the average levels of ?-carotene on the Capsicum annuum L. Var. abreviatum Fingerhuth was (10,54±0,07) mg/100g, Capsicum annuum L. Var. Longum sendt was (5,57±0,13) mg/100g and Capsicum frutescens L. was about (0,36±0,01) mg/100g. Statistical analysis using LSD test of ?-carotene levels in the Capsicum annuum L. Var. abreviatum Fingerhuth, Capsicum annuum L. Var. Longum sendt) and Capsicum frutescens L. were significantly different at P of 0.05.
